What does a Production Designer (Film, Television Production) do?

Set designers develop a set concept for a performance and supervise the execution of it. They design and create the settings for commercials, television, theatre and films.

Tasks required include:

  • Liaises with client to determine the purpose, cost, technical specification and potential uses/users of product.
  • Prepares sketches, designs, patterns, prototypes, mock-ups and storyboards for consideration by theatre/film director, management, sales department or a client.
  • Undertakes research to determine market trends, production requirements, availability of resources and formulates design concepts.
  • Specifies materials, production method and finish for aesthetic or functional effect, and oversees production of sample and/or finished product.
  • Observes and manages intellectual property issues.

What are the entry requirements for a Production Designer (Film, Television Production)?

Entrants have usually completed a foundation course, BTEC/SQA award, degree and/or postgraduate qualification. A variety of vocational qualifications are available.
